Just got home from a couple of weeks away and my new wheel was in. It's in near immaculate condition and I couldn't be happier for the price.

Also got an new interior light dome, engine wiring loom ziptie clips, door trim clips and new genuine ashtray.

The ashtrays a lot darker than the other one. Not sure if it's supposed to be or if there were multiple versions. Regardless it's not chipped or scratched so it's much better than the original.

I also have new V8 badges for the side fenders on the way and should show up Friday.

The interiors looks awesome finally. It Isn't perfect by any means but I'm bloody happy from where it started Next plan will be the handbrake boot and window tint as the drivers side is dying.
